Program Analysis
At $36,059 per year, Business Administration graduates from Alfred University earn below the $46,892 national average. Lower costs or geographic factors may offset the earnings gap.
The 3.3x return on tuition is positive but not overwhelming. Financial outcomes depend on keeping costs close to in-state rates.
AI risk is moderate — 47% task exposure — and the 8% scenario spread suggests disruption would dent but not destroy the earnings outlook.
The $24,776 debt-to-$36,059 income ratio translates to about 8 months of earnings. Standard loan terms should handle this comfortably.
At #1127 out of 1,169 programs, Alfred University's financial outcomes for Business Administration trail the majority of peers. The value case depends on other factors.
The five-year earnings trajectory from $36,059 to $52,309 shows 45% growth, reflecting steady but unremarkable salary progression.
